Double Glazed Repairs Near Me

Double glazed windows are an excellent addition to any home. They can improve the insulation qualities of your home and help reduce your energy bills.

However, they could create issues, such as misting over time. This can be a hassle and affect the appearance of your windows.

Repairing double glazing is possible at a fraction the cost of replacing double glazed glass windows.

Broken or Damaged Panes

Double-glazed windows consist of two panes, with an air space between them, which is filled with inert gases such as argon and krypton. This allows heat to pass through while reducing the speed to ensure that your home doesn't get too hot.

However, this assembly can be damaged and broken and cause condensation between the panes of windows or drafts passing through the window. This could not only affect the insulation of your home but will also increase your the cost of energy if it's not replaced.

Experts are able to perform the majority of double glazing repairs. However, you must be able to identify the root of the issue. You should inspect your windows at least every year to determine if there is damage. This could include cracks in the glass or loose seal. You should also to feel condensation between panes or feel a draft in your home. It's better to call a professional than to try to fix the problem yourself.

One thing to keep in mind is that a cracked window pane can break into large pieces. This is due to tensile stress which occurs when glass is stretched too far. To avoid this occurring, you must replace a window when it is damaged, instead of waiting.

The first step in repairing damaged or broken window pane is to clean the frame and remove any glass fragments that may have escaped. To ensure your hands are safe it is important to wear gloves. You'll need to take any old caulking or putty from around the edges of the frame. After the frame is put together you can then add new putty to the frame and then replace the window pane.

Some companies will drill double glazing that has misted up to eliminate the moisture. This is a temporary fix and won't enhance the performance of double glazing. The best solution is finding a double glazing repair specialist who is reliable and experienced and then having them repair the window and all its components.

Seals

The seals on windows stop heat from getting between the panes of a triple or double-paned window. If a window seal becomes faulty, it will allow condensation and air to pass through the windows which is not just unattractive but also compromises the insulation properties of your home's windows. It is essential to repair a broken seal as soon as possible.

Many people think they can repair a double-glazed window seal by themselves, but this isn't always an ideal idea. Double-glazed windows are a complex system that requires a skilled and experienced tradesperson to repair. If you attempt to repair it yourself, you may end up making the issue worse or causing further damage to your windows. It is best to leave this kind of job to the professionals. Window seals that aren't working properly usually announce themselves loudly, causing a build-up of condensation between glass panes which can't be wiped away. A window with a damaged seal could also create a hazy, wavy look that can distort the view inside or outside your home. The damaged seals aren't just unattractive, they also drastically decrease the insulation qualities of your window. They also make your home more costly to cool and heat.

In some cases you might be able to repair a window seal without needing to replace the entire frame. If your window is covered by warranty or you have an agreement with the company that installed it, they will often come to repair the seal for free.

It is important to check the seals on your windows regularly, especially if they are older than 15 to 20 years. This is because they deteriorate over time, and could cause a range of issues including fogging, drafts, and high energy bills. Some window seals can be left to stand. However, it is best to get them repaired when you spot the problem.

Frames

It may be possible to repair double glazed windows your frames if they're damaged or loose, rather than replacing the entire window. A local double glazing repair service will often provide quick and efficient repairs. They can also offer suggestions on how to keep your windows and doors in good working order. They typically have an extensive selection of styles and colours for you to choose from.

A survey of the owners of double glazing that was new found that a few had issues with the frames or mechanisms. This included windows becoming difficult to open and close and doors dropping or sagging over time. These issues can be resolved by lubricating hinges and handles or tightening loose fixings. If the issue persists, it's best to get an expert examine the issue.

Another common complaint was the frames allowing draughts to enter the room, or allowing damp, cold air to penetrate. There are some things that can be done to prevent this from happening, such as installing trickle vents on the frame or building up insulation in the walls around the windows. Some people have tried to block out the cold by putting up blinds or curtains but this could lead to condensation and mould.

Double glazing that has mist is often the result of moisture buildup between the glass panes. This can be due to seals that are dirty or condensation, or the combination of both. If you notice misty double glazing, it is important to determine the cause of the issue and fix it as quickly as you can. If moisture isn't addressed it could leak into the cavity causing wood rot.

A damp cloth is the ideal method to clean windows. This will get rid of the majority of dirt and grime, but if the frames appear especially difficult to remove or have deep grooves you can use cleaning fluid. You should always test the cleaning solution on a small area of the frame to ensure it will not damage or stain it.

The process of having your double-glazed windows repaired is a great way to improve their energy efficiency and ensure they look as good as new. It's also less expensive than replacing the entire window.

Glass

Double-glazed windows come with many advantages, such as saving energy and making your home more quiet. However, they may encounter issues from time to time, such as misted glass or condensation between the panes. In these cases, it is often better to opt instead for targeted maintenance than replacement. However, it's important to keep in mind that you should only rely on an experienced double glazing company to repair your window. This is because specialized tools are needed and it's crucial that the repairs are done in a timely manner.

In most instances, replacing a damaged double-glazed window is not enough. It could also involve fixing the energy rating of the window by removing old seals and putting in new. If your double-glazed windows have lost their energy-efficient rating, you should contact the company from which you purchased them as soon as possible and describe the problem. This should be done in person or via the phone and then followed-up by a letter or an email.

If you're lucky, the business will send someone out to fix your window free of charge or for a very small cost. In some instances, they may not be able to help and will suggest that you replace your window completely. This will most likely occur if your window is severely damaged or is afflicted with mould or rot.

You might be able to repair the crack yourself in certain cases by using heavy-duty tape. This will stop superficial cracks, such as stress cracks caused by low temperatures from worsening. You should apply strong-hold tapes, such as masking tape, and extend it outwards over the crack on both sides to hold it in the right position.

Double-glazed window crack repair may also be accomplished by applying epoxy to the damaged area. This option is more labor-intensive but it will make your broken window appear new once it is repaired. Before you do this, you must clean the area around and over the crack of glass using soap and water. Follow the instructions on the epoxy and apply it evenly on both surfaces.Glass-Replacement-150x150.jpg
